1. Dead or Dying Branches
Trees are an indispensable part of your home's landscape, providing shade and beauty. They additionally provide shelter for wildlife and generate oxygen, yet even healthy and balanced trees can experience health issue that might require their removal. Dead or dying trees aren't simply undesirable, they can be dangerous. Their branches could drop during a tornado, causing costly residential property damage and injuries.

When a tree's branches start to pass away, it suggests that its framework is starting to break down. If most of its branches are dead, it is likely time to remove it.

Look for a lack of new growth, bark peeling, open wounds or tooth cavities, fungis expanding on the trunk or roots and a basic look of degeneration in the entire canopy. These signs of infection can indicate a major problem that will certainly require professional tree services to deal with.

2. Leaning Trunk
While it's normal for trees to lean from time to time because of phototropism, if a tree has an unsafe or serious lean that's not as a result of natural processes - maybe an indicator that the tree requires to be gotten rid of. If the tree is favoring a power line, home, car, play structure or any other location that could be dangerous to individuals if it drops, then calling a professional tree solution for removal ought to be a top concern.

It's additionally essential to expect any type of sudden changes in a tree's leaning as it can show damages to the roots or trunk that might result in falling. 3. Parasite Infestation
Some pest infestations, such as wood-boring bugs like emerald ash borer or sap-suckers like range bugs, are so serious that they can create a tree to die. The best way to avoid pest problem is to monitor your trees often. Look for spots, openings, or discolorations in the leaves and bark. Analyze the trunk for cracks and signs of insect damages, such as passages or tracks.

4. Damaged Trunk
Trees are a beautiful and integral part of our landscape, but they do call for routine care to maintain them healthy and balanced and secure. If a tree is harmed beyond repair it is most likely time for it ahead down.

Search for indications of damage to the trunk, consisting of vertical splits, seams, dead branch stubs, visible wounds or open cavities and extreme tree-rot. The presence of fungi at the base of the trunk is another alerting indicator. Fungis may indicate that the phloem and xylem (life-support tissues) are endangered, permitting the spread of illness or a future failing.



Also, consider whether the tree has actually stopped expanding. Healthy and balanced trees will have new growth every year, which might be visible as buds or branches sprouting and expanding. If you don't see any type of new development, it's a good idea to have an arborist evaluate the tree and follow their suggestion for elimination. A dying or harmed tree can fall and cause residential or commercial property damages.
